BACKGROUND Clinical reasoning has long been a valuable tool for health care practitioners, but it has been under-researched in the field of massage therapy. Case reports have been a useful method for exploring the clinical reasoning process in various fields of manual therapy and can provide a model for similar research in the field of massage therapy. OBJECTIVES The effect of massage therapy on chronic nonmigraine headache was investigated. METHODS Chronic tension headache sufferers received structured massage therapy treatment directed toward neck and shoulder muscles. BACKGROUND Adipocytes in femoral areas are known to be metabolically 'silent'. Changes related to fat cell hypertrophy may be involved in the formation of cellulite. A mechanical massage technique, with circulatory and dermotrophic properties, has been shown to have an impact on clinical evaluations (i.e. changes in morphometric measurements) in cellulite areas.
